What units here actually rent for

1-bed$518–$630/wkmedian $58099 bonds, Q2 2026
2-bed$600–$700/wkmedian $650306 bonds, Q2 2026

Real transacted rents — every residential bond lodged in postcode 2145 (NSW Fair Trading, CC-BY). Postcode is the finest geography the source publishes; the middle half (25th–75th percentile) is shown because identical floor plans in one building can lease hundreds apart.
